John's Drive-In 7.8
Englewood
A classic neighborhood breakfast-and-sandwich stop where the draw is straightforward execution and a steady morning rhythm. The wins are the griddle and diner basics—pancakes, bacon, hash browns, and simple sandwiches—built for quick takeout or a no-fuss sit-down.
Must-Try Dishes: Pancakes, Club sandwich, Hash browns
Scores:
Value: 8.5 Service: 7.4 Consistency: 7.6 Food Quality: 8.1 Atmosphere: 6.1 Cultural Relevance: 7.2
What makes it special: A no-frills breakfast counter built around griddle staples and speed.
Who should go: Breakfast locals and quick lunch stop regulars
When to visit: Early morning for the smoothest service
What to order: Pancakes, club sandwich, hash browns
Insider tip: Order the griddle item fresh and eat it hot—timing matters here.
Logistics & Planning
Parking: Primarily street parking on surrounding residential blocks; availability is usually good early morning but can tighten up during peak brunch hours.
Dress code: Very casual; everyday streetwear, work clothes, or gym gear all fit in.
Noise level: Low to moderate - typical diner chatter, easy to hold a conversation.
Weekend wait: Not typically a dinner destination; during late-morning weekend rush expect a short 5–15 minute wait.
Weekday lunch: Usually no wait or a few minutes at most.
Dietary Options
Vegetarian options: Yes - egg dishes, pancakes, hash browns, and simple grilled cheese or veggie sandwiches.
Vegan options: Limited - possible to piece together toast, hash browns, and some sides, but no dedicated vegan mains.
Gluten-free options: Limited - eggs and some plate items can be ordered without bread, but no dedicated gluten-free substitutes.
Best For
Better for: Quick, classic breakfast and sandwich runs where speed and familiarity matter more than atmosphere.
Consider Alternatives If: You’re looking for specialty brunch dishes, craft coffee, or a long, relaxed sit-down experience.
